(Criteria are: relevant timing, size and capability (esp. vs the existing US and Japanese ships already in play) , historical significance and distinctiveness/fun to play ... )
Tier I : Triumph (designed for Chile to beat Armoured Cruisers - cute little fastish pre dreads - 4 x 12inch and 14 7.5 inch - lots of fun vs, cruisers at shorter ranges)
Tier 2: Lord Nelson - great Semi Dreads 4 x 12 and 10 x 9.2s ..... - again pack a lot of firepower ...
Tier 3: Dreadnought and Invincible (no real choice here ... )
Tier 4: Agincourt (crazy brazilian design 7x2 x 12 inch .... - a 14 gun broadsise was a sight to behold !!! - also a bit fast for BB then and thinner armour - altogether very distinctive - can match up to the 12 x 12 inch US (Wyoming) and Japanese (Kawachi)
Tier 5: getting complicated ... BB (vs, New York) - Iron Duke (Flagship at Jutland) and BC (vs. Kongo): of course Tiger is half sister to the Kongos and Renown/Repulse very similar capabilities and come with all the inter-war and WW2 type modernisations as historical ...
Tier 6: of course Warspite is already there .. - but obviously need to add Hood as well ... (as completed she is pretty much a Fast QE and The prototype Fast BB ... )
Tier 7: really has to be Rodney (contemporary to Colorado and Nagato, so distinctive and aggressive with 3 Triple 16 inch all up front and what else can demolish a Bismarck with barely a scratch on her ... )
But very crowded here - need to also fit in KGV (well balanced ships and historically very significant) and Vanguard - the most beautiful BB of all ...
Tier 8: Lion - (possibly best ever RN BB design and with 30 knots and 9 x 16 inch is best counterpart to North Carolina and Amagi )
Tier 9: G3 (ordered but not built - WNT) - let's see how they compare to Iowa ...
Tier 10: N3 (The British Sumo ... (designed but not built - WNT) the only design with 9 x 18 inch to set up vs Yamato ...
